Dwanna Swan Hadrick
D WANNA L A F AYE S WAN was born on January 8, 1969 to Burl Swan (deceased) and Gwendolyn Swan at Parkland Hospital in Dallas, TX. Even though Dwanna was born a healthy 6 lb. 7 oz unfortunately she was also born with a very rare medical condition called Lipodystrophy. Doctors said she wouldn’t live past 12 years old. In Dwanna’s early years she faced many challenges with her health. Some days were easy while most days were not because of her medical condition. She never complained nor did she allow it to stop her from reaching her goals or dreams. In life she drew her strength from it. Dwanna was introduced to Christ at a very early age and Dwanna’s love for God family and people became her purpose passion and destiny in life. Dwanna was a very beautiful, smart, kind, loving, giving, intelligent, peaceful human being. She was very mild tempered and if she wasn’t let’s just say someone else changed her temper and she had to let them know who she was. Dwanna was filled with knowledge and passionate about her education. Dwanna graduated from Chisolm Trail Academy in 1987 (high school). After high school, Dwanna attended Hill Junior College in 1992 and received her associate of science. She went on to attend Amber University where she received Master of Science in 1997. After attending Amber University she went on to attend Southwest Texas State University College of Health Professions where she received her Assisted Living Management Certificate program in 2001. During this time, Dwanna met and married her first husband Derrick Ary they were married in 2003 with this union came their fur babies (dogs), Tub Tub, Rascal and the one and only diva of the bunch Precious. They later adopted Georgie, Cisco, Alex and Maxima. Dwanna has always been strong, gifted, successful, businesswoman, with a work ethic like no other. While being a wife, a mother to her fur babies She started and ran a business. Her business was CSA Enterprise, Inc. Her love for helping people with disabilities is what led her to create CSA Enterprise Inc. Her passion to touch, change and impact lives was her true calling. While changing lives, she continued to change her own she attended Capella University where she received her Doctor of Philosophy in Human Services with specialization in health care administration in 2011. When I say my sister was educated, she was very educated. Dwanna loved to travel, loved to cook and she loved helping people. Dr. Dwanna also became a public speaker and a voice for people living with Lipodystrophy. She would travel to speaking engagements all across the US to speak about the research and work being done in Lipodystrophy, so her medical condition never dictated or stopped her life, it fueled it. In February 2020, her husband Derrick had a stroke and she would be right by his side until the pandemic (hospital rules during this time would not allow her to be by his side).
